I am running a tube chassismustang on a 1/3 mile low banking and am looking for a good starting point as well? was told set the car to ride height and put 40-60lbs of bite in it? my qestion is do i need to concern myself with the cross weight? I have run pavement for 15 years, never have i tried dirt!! Any advice would be appreciated thanks

okay, the car is a tube chassis with a mustang front subframe and rack the rear is a 3 link with coil overs rf 300 lf450 5x8 coil srping, rr 175 lr 125 coil over springs. does that sound correct?

To start I would go a lot stiffer on front springs, I run a 750# RF & 650# LF. Swap rear springs, heavier rate on LR, your rear spring rates look a little soft but should work. I run a stock susp. mustang & it works good.
